Imperfect Storms:  New Work From East Anglian Writers

Imperfect Storms is an exciting evening of new work, written by East Anglian members of the Writers Guild of Great Britain. Between them these writers have credits in TV, film, theatre, radio, books, comedy, poetry and video games, and the evening promises to be diverse and full of surprises. These are works in progress, fresh off the printer and presented in a rehearsed reading.

Last years show featured singing highwaymen, zombies looking for love and a blue-haired Danny Boyle. The evening will again be curated by regional chair, Stephen Keyworth, whose recent credits include Haunted Deepdale for Slow Theatre, Radio 4’s The Princess Bride and BBC1’s Doctors.

The WGGB have been representing and campaigning for working writers since 1959. Ticket proceeds will enable the Guild to continue supporting writers in the East of England.
